LINQ to SQL语句的使用方法有哪些
发表于:2025-11-17 作者:千家信息网编辑
千家信息网最后更新 2025年11月17日,这篇文章主要介绍"LINQ to SQL语句的使用方法有哪些",在日常操作中,相信很多人在LINQ to SQL语句的使用方法有哪些问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对
千家信息网最后更新 2025年11月17日LINQ to SQL语句的使用方法有哪些
这篇文章主要介绍"LINQ to SQL语句的使用方法有哪些",在日常操作中,相信很多人在LINQ to SQL语句的使用方法有哪些问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答"LINQ to SQL语句的使用方法有哪些"的疑惑有所帮助!接下来,请跟着小编一起来学习吧!
LINQ to SQL语句简单形式
说明:new一个对象,使用InsertOnSubmit方法将其加入到对应的集合中,使用SubmitChanges()提交到数据库。
NorthwindDataContext db = new NorthwindDataContext(); var newnewCustomer = new Customer { CustomerID = "MCSFT", CompanyName = "Microsoft", ContactName = "John Doe", ContactTitle = "Sales Manager", Address = "1 Microsoft Way", City = "Redmond", Region = "WA", PostalCode = "98052", Country = "USA", Phone = "(425) 555-1234", Fax = null };语句描述:使用InsertOnSubmit方法将新客户添加到Customers 表对象。调用SubmitChanges 将此新Customer保存到数据库。
LINQ to SQL语句一对多关系
说明:Category与Product是一对多的关系,提交Category(一端)的数据时,LINQ to SQL会自动将Product(多端)的数据一起提交。
var newnewCategory = new Category { CategoryName = "Widgets", Description = "Widgets are the ……" }; var newnewProduct = new Product { ProductName = "Blue Widget", UnitPrice = 34.56M, Category = newCategory };语句描述:使用InsertOnSubmit方法将新类别添加到Categories表中,并将新Product对象添加到与此新Category有外键关系的Products表中。调用SubmitChanges将这些新对象及其关系保存到数据库。
LINQ to SQL语句多对多关系
说明:在多对多关系中,我们需要依次提交。
var newnewEmployee = new Employee { FirstName = "Kira", LastName = "Smith" }; var newnewTerritory = new Territory { TerritoryID = "12345", TerritoryDescription = "Anytown", Region = db.Regions.First() }; var newnewEmployeeTerritory = new EmployeeTerritory { Employee = newEmployee, Territory = newTerritory };到此,关于"LINQ to SQL语句的使用方法有哪些"的学习就结束了,希望能够解决大家的疑惑。理论与实践的搭配能更好的帮助大家学习,快去试试吧!若想继续学习更多相关知识,请继续关注网站,小编会继续努力为大家带来更多实用的文章!
语句
方法
数据
使用方法
对象
学习
数据库
更多
帮助
实用
接下来
一端
客户
形式
文章
理论
知识
篇文章
类别
网站
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
宜兴质量软件开发怎么样
学dj和学软件开发
腾讯云服务器中国公司
四平软件开发
普通人买阿里服务器什么用
两台电脑都有数据库怎么共享数据
网络安全人人有责主题班会
软件开发需求书下载
人工智能文件服务器
网络安全法网络暴力
一对一数据库应用
需求定义错误的软件开发案例
深圳千里马软件开发有限公司
公司网络安全用什么软件
oracle数据库空格
潜江哪里有软件开发企业
软件开发企划书百度网盘
黄浦区营销软件开发项目
接入网络技术论文
配置你的数据库信息
最强网络安全工程师
网络安全国家培训
杭州碧橙网络技术招聘
网络安全法网络暴力
大鹏软件开发工作室
网络安全教育周学生学习照片
网络安全 公司 广播电视局
谷歌邮箱的服务器
广州微信软件开发外包
计算机软件开发使用的抽象有